Output 3ee8bf2fcd46c432e68fe0a9063ab224298f0eec4a53f7ce178e5c852ce44d62:5

value
23462795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89badc1ac425c4ab9003043e95cc77228d6d16af OP_EQUAL
address
MLTQexRJzHLTdzZKRfYLLpcDMVpYvqdyMx
transaction
3ee8bf2fcd46c432e68fe0a9063ab224298f0eec4a53f7ce178e5c852ce44d62
spent
true